The Problem
“Turn briefs into on-brand ad concepts and variants across copy, image, and video”
Organizations face these key challenges:
Creative development bottlenecks: concepts and variations can't be produced fast enough for ongoing paid media testing
Inconsistent brand voice across teams, agencies, and markets; frequent rework from brand/legal reviews
High production cost for variants (especially video) that may never outperform controls
Creative performance insights are fragmented; learnings don’t translate into the next batch of ideas

Quick Win
Brief-to-Concept Copy Studio
A lightweight assistant that converts a campaign brief into structured ad concepts and copy variants (hooks, headlines, primary text, CTAs) for specific channels. It uses prompt patterns and few-shot examples to enforce tone, length limits, and platform best practices, producing ready-to-paste drafts for human refinement.

Key Challenges
- ⚠Brand voice drift without grounding content in guidelines/examples
- ⚠Hallucinated claims (e.g., performance promises) that may violate compliance
- ⚠Difficulty producing truly diverse concepts vs. shallow paraphrases
- ⚠No systematic link between generated ideas and measured performance
